Solar panel power generation volts

Solar panel power generation volts

Most residential solar panels generate between 16-40 volts DC, with an average of around 30 volts per panel under ideal conditions. This is the maximum rated voltage under direct sunlight if the circuit is open (no current running through the. . Solar panel output voltage typically ranges from 5-40 volts for individual panels, with system voltages reaching up to 1500V for large-scale installations. However, the actual voltage fluctuates based on temperature, sunlight intensity, shading, panel age and quality. It's analogous to water pressure in a pipe. A higher voltage means a greater potential to push electrons through a circuit.

Solar panel power generation back temperature

Solar panel power generation back temperature

The optimal solar panel performance temperature is around 25°C, or 77°F. While many homeowners assume that hotter weather means better solar production, the reality is more nuanced. Temperature significantly impacts how efficiently your solar. . While solar panels harness sunlight efficiently, their power output typically decreases by 0. A solar panel's current and voltage output is affected by changing weather conditions, and must be adjusted to. . Since solar panels rely on the sun's energy, it's common to think that they will produce more electricity when temperatures rise. Photovoltaic solar systems convert direct sunlight into electricity.
